Lauren Sanchez is making major headlines this week after she and husband Jeff Bezos were revealed as the lead sponsors for the 2026 Met Gala, in what CEO Today characterizes as a billion-dollar play that is sending waves through the worlds of art, fashion, and big business. This is not just a philanthropic gesture—sources close to the Met’s Costume Institute say Lauren is actively making creative decisions and curating the guest list, with Bezos backing her vision financially. Anna Wintour, the longtime arbiter of the gala, even singled out Sanchez’s creative drive and generosity at a recent Doha gala, calling her a wonderful asset to the event and museum. With Vogue under new leadership and Chloe Malle overseeing the 2026 gala, Sanchez’s influence comes at a pivotal time, as the industry pivots from fashion house sponsorships to billionaire patrons steering cultural conversation and funding.
The Met Gala sponsorship positions Lauren Sanchez as a central player in the rarefied space where culture, wealth, and power intersect. The upcoming theme, “Costume Art,” will be anchored by an expanded exhibition at the Met that runs into 2027. According to The Independent, Lauren’s move is a clear escalation of her and Bezos’s ambitions to cement their reputation as a power couple in the global celebrity and cultural circuit, drawing comparisons to legendary duos like Posh and Becks.
